The way I see it : mobile communications

Here's an article that really shows the big difference between the implementation of cellphone technology from Apple and Google.

Apple has a tightly controlled application environment. You have to conform to their standards, and even then, your application may not make it to the iPhone application market. Then, if it does make it, it might still be pulled after it's hit the market and been downloaded.

Not so with Google. Their open-source implementation on it's admittedly clunky first-gen G1 phone will open their Google apps market to all developers. Instead of Google having the control, the holder of the phone does.
